ATSW is a complete replacement for Blizzards tradeskill window with more overview and special functions.

This replacement (works for all tradeskills, now even enchanting!) provides you with:

- a better overview
The ATSW is bigger than the standard window, resulting in a much better overview over the thousands of items you can produce. Additionally, it lets you sort your recipes either by groups (as in the standard window), alphabetically or by difficulty. Alternatively, ATSW even lets you create your own groups and sort the recipes the way you like!
ATSW also has a filter function: enter something into the filter line and ATSW hides all recipes that don't contain the text you entered. But this filter function can do more: it's a powerful search function that can filter for minimum/maximum level requirements, producable item counts, item rarity (color) and reagents necessary. Check out the readme for details on using this function!

- more comfort
The ATSW has a production queue: you can queue several different items and have them all produced automatically by just clicking one button.
The ATSW is able to consider items you have to produce in order to use them as reagents in the production of other items. So: if you need item A to produce item B, you don't have to manually produce first item A, then item B. The ATSW does that for you: you just tell it to produce item B and it automatically queues the production of item A and - afterwards - item B. If you are missing some reagents to produce both items you get a message telling you exactly which reagents you need.
ATSW helps you telling your friends what reagents you need for a specific item: just click on a recipe with your shift-key pressed and the chat line opened and the reagent info will be added to the chat line.
ATSW shows you what reagents you need to process the whole production queue. It even tells you how many of each reagent you have in your bank, on alternative characters on the same server (in this case, it can even tell you on which characters) and which reagents are buyable from merchants. In case of buyable reagents ATSW can automatically buy all missing and available items from a merchant when you are speaking to him.


Please note that ATSW has grown to be quite a complex addon and it might still contain some bugs. Please tell me if you encounter one so I can fix them.

ATSW is localized in german, english and french language.

    @Everyone trying to sort/filter the lists:

    Check the file named README.txt in the Interface/Addons/AdvancedTradeSkillsWindow folder as it lists a great deal of information about the filters that are present. To use the filters -- as opposed to a standard search -- you enter a colon : followed by the filter name.

    To check only what you can craft on hand it's ":minpossible 1" and for craftable with mats given the options you selected in the Options tab it's ":minpossibletotal 1". You can also restrict the listing by level req's for the items, etc for crafting for Alts and so on.

    This is obviously not the same as adding a simple checkbox for this same functionality. I'd rather see some of the outstanding bugs dealt with first but that's just me.
